'''Lossless Predictive Audio Compression (LPAC)''' is an improved [[lossless compression|lossless]] [[audio compression]] algorithm developed by [[Tilman Liebchen]], [[Marcus Purat]] and [[Peter Noll]] at [http://www.nue.tu-berlin.de/index_e.html Institute for Telecommunications], Technical University [[Berlin]] ([[TU Berlin]]), to compress PCM audio in a [[lossless compression|lossless]] manner, ''unlike'' conventional [[audio compression]] algorithms which are [[lossy compression|lossy]].
 
Meanwhile it is no longer developed because an advanced version of it has become an official standard under the name of [[Audio Lossless Coding|MPEG-4 [[Audio Lossless Coding]].
